I BOUGHT A BICYCLE!!!!!   It’s a Gazelle Impala model made somewhere between 1900 and yesterday.  Even the French refer to them as “Holland” bicycles, in that they are those old beautiful cruisers that are quintessentially Dutch.  Gazelles are indeed made in Holland.  The French like them too.

My Gazelle is exactly what I was looking for; very “vintage” looking (read, “rusty”), has drum brakes, mechanical brake linkages, a cable actuated 3 speed internal hub, a dynamo-driven headlight, leather Brookes saddle, full leather chain guard etc.  Tres cool.
